APSLEY HOUSE, London. " Interior with a Cavalier drinking and a couple embracing" 1690s by Willem Van MIERIS (1662-1747). WM 1526-1948

This print showcases the exquisite painting titled "Interior with a Cavalier drinking and a couple embracing" by Willem Van Mieris. Created in the 1690s, this Dutch masterpiece beautifully captures an intimate moment frozen in time. The scene unfolds within a lavish interior of Apsley House, London, adding to its historical significance. At the center of attention is a cavalier figure indulging in his drink, exuding an air of sophistication and mystery. His elegant attire and confident demeanor hint at his noble status, while his raised glass suggests he is celebrating life's pleasures. Meanwhile, on the right side of the composition, we witness a tender embrace between a couple deeply immersed in their love for each other. Their affectionate gesture speaks volumes about human connection and intimacy. Willem Van Mieris masterfully employs light and shadow to create depth and texture within this artwork. The intricate details are brought to life through careful brushstrokes that highlight every fold of fabric or glimmering reflection on glassware.
